Collections

Unknown
Angelcirca 1350-1400

Not on view
Stone sculpture of a full-length angel with curled hair, raised wings with diamond-patterned feathers, holding a scroll-like object aloft, in a long draped robe
Plaster sculpture of a standing robed figure holding a large flat form, with two faces visible at upper left and right; heavily textured surface with rasp marks and irregular voids throughout the torso.
Artist or Maker
Unknown
Title
Angel
Place Made
France, Burgundy
Date Made
circa 1350-1400
Medium
Limestone with traces of polychromy
Dimensions
21 1/4 x 9 x 7 1/4 in. (53.97 x 22.86 x 18.41 cm)
Credit Line
Gift of Anna Bing Arnold
Accession Number
53.28.12
Classification
Sculpture
Collecting Area
European Painting and Sculpture
Selected Bibliography
  • Schaefer, Scott, and Peter Fusco. European Painting and Sculpture in the Los Angeles County Museum of Art: an Illustrated Summary Catalogue. Los Angeles: Los Angeles County Museum of Art, 1987.
